I wrecked pretty bad a week ago and bent my steerer tube. The guy at the bike shop said all I could do was buy a new fork. But can I order a crown and steerer and just swap that out or do the legs not detach? It kinda seems like they don't. Any help is greatly appreciated!

As tough as it is to hear, it is probbably not cost-effective to do that to a C. The parts cost and work involved will be near the cost of a similar or slightly upgraded unit, so I would say bite the bullet and get a whole new unit. There is also a chance that there will be other internal dammage such as deformed bushings from a crash like that.

if you did replace it, you would be replacing the whole upper part: steerer, crown, stanchions (sp?) and possibly some other internals connected with the upper parts, waste of time and money unless its an older design (i dunno if rockshox ever did this) and you can unbolt the crown from the stanchions and your lucky enough to find spares for it then what i said before... and yeah considering its just a judy C i wouldnt bother
